Matt Cardona recently addressed remarks made by fellow professional wrestlers Kevin Owens and Cody Rhodes regarding his independent circuit branding and his long-running pursuit of a return to WWE. According to an interview on the Insight Podcast with Chris Van Vliet, Cardona admitted he felt frustrated by how his career trajectory and public statements were characterized by his colleagues.

Matt Cardona Addresses Cody Rhodes and Kevin Owens Comments

The friction stems from an appearance Cardona made in June 2024 on Cody Rhodes’ What Do You Wanna Talk About? podcast. During that episode, Rhodes and Owens discussed Cardona’s self-styled persona as the “Indy God,” teasing his eventual comeback to WWE while poking fun at his frequent mentions of the company.

Reflecting on the exchange to Chris Van Vliet, Cardona stated that he was initially angered by the portrayal. “Oh boy. Honestly, I was pissed! Because they made it seem that all I would say is I want to be back in WWE. Blah blah. I’d only talk about it when I’d be doing things like this, and you ask me a question. So it bothered me, but I’m over it now,” Cardona said.

Despite his initial frustration, Cardona clarified that he does not believe the comments were delivered with malicious intent. However, he noted that he lacked an immediate platform to present his side of the story until he officially re-signed with the company.

“Yes, it wasn’t malicious. I just did not appreciate that I didn’t get a chance to come on and tell my version until I got re-signed,” Cardona added.

WWE Return and Indy God Rebrand

Cardona ultimately made his surprise return to WWE in November 2025 as an entrant in John Cena’s Last Time Is Now Tournament. Prior to his official re-signing, he competed on WWE NXT following that brand’s working relationship with TNA Wrestling. He was officially added to the SmackDown roster earlier this year.

The “Indy God” moniker became synonymous with Cardona following his initial WWE release in 2020, a departure that arrived at the peak popularity of his Zack Ryder persona. Establishing himself as a top fixture outside of mainstream television before finding his way back to the promotion.
